How much do clinical operations associate jobs pay per hour?

As of Sep 1, 2026, the average hourly pay for clinical operations associate in Navarre, FL is $24.17,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$16.39 and $27.88 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a clinical operations associate?

A Clinical Operations Associate supports the planning, execution, and management of clinical trials to ensure compliance with regulatory guidelines and company protocols. They assist in coordinating trial logistics, managing documentation, and communicating with study sites and stakeholders. Their role helps ensure studies run efficiently, meet regulatory requirements, and generate reliable data for drug development and approvals.

What are the typical responsibilities and team dynamics for a clinical operations associate?

As a Clinical Operations Associate, your typical responsibilities include coordinating study activities, maintaining trial documentation, supporting regulatory submissions, and ensuring adherence to protocols and timelines. You will often work as part of a multi-disciplinary team that includes clinical research coordinators, data managers, and study monitors, frequently communicating with internal and external stakeholders to keep the study on track. Collaboration and adaptability are key, as priorities can shift based on site needs or regulatory updates. This role offers valuable exposure to the operations side of clinical research and can serve as a springboard to more senior roles such as Clinical Project Manager or Clinical Research Associate.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the clinical operations associate position,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Clinical Operations Associate, you need a solid background in clinical research processes, project management, and regulatory compliance, often supported by a degree in life sciences or a related field. Familiarity with clinical trial management systems (CTMS), electronic data capture (EDC) platforms, and Good Clinical Practice (GCP) certification is highly valued. Attention to detail, strong organizational skills, and effective communication are important soft skills that help manage complex studies and collaborate with cross-functional teams. These abilities are crucial for ensuring that clinical trials run smoothly, meet regulatory standards, and maintain participant safety.

About ATI Physical Therapy

Sourced by ZipRecruiter

ATI Physical Therapy, headquartered in Bolingbrook, Illinois, is a leader in the physical therapy industry in the United States. Established in 1996 by physical therapist Greg Steil, ATI Physical Therapy has grown to house over 860 clinic locations across the country. They provide a host of services encompassing physical therapy, sports medicine, workers’ compensation services, home health, and more. The company’s mission is to exceed customer expectations by providing the highest quality of care in a friendly and encouraging environment.
